package pointer
import (
"fmt"
"testing"
)
func TestByte(t *testing.T) {
tests := []byte{
0, 'a', '\007', '\t',
}
for _, v := range tests {
var p *byte = Byte(v)
if p == nil {
t.Errorf("Byte(%v) = nil; want %v", v, v)
}
if n := ByteValue(p); n != v {
t.Errorf("Byte(%v) = %v; want %v", v, n, v)
}
}
}
func TestByteSlice(t *testing.T) {
data := []byte{
0, 'a', '\007', '\t',
}
a := ByteSlice(data...)
if len(a) != len(data) {
t.Errorf("len(slice) = %d; want %d", len(a), len(data))
return
}
for i, p := range a {
v := data[i]
switch {
case p == nil:
t.Errorf("ByteSlice(%v)[%d] = nil; want %v", data, i, v)
case *p != v:
t.Errorf("ByteSlice(%v)[%d] = %v; want %v", data, i, *p, v)
}
}
}
func TestByteValue_Nil(t *testing.T) {
var zero byte
v := ByteValue(nil)
if v != zero {
t.Errorf("ByteValue(nil) = %v; want %v", v, zero)
}
}
func TestEqualByte(t *testing.T) {
tests := []struct {
v1, v2 *byte
eq bool
}{
{Byte(0), Byte('a'), false},
{Byte(0), Byte(0), true},
{Byte('a'), Byte('a'), true},
{nil, nil, true},
{nil, Byte(0), false},
{Byte(0), nil, false},
}
for _, tt := range tests {
if eq := EqualByte(tt.v1, tt.v2); eq != tt.eq {
t.Errorf("EqualByte(%d, %d) = %t; want %t", tt.v1, tt.v2, eq, tt.eq)
}
}
}
func TestByteFormatterFormat(t *testing.T) {
tests := []struct {
p *byte
s string
}{
{Byte(0), fmt.Sprintf("%v", 0)},
{Byte('a'), fmt.Sprintf("%v", 'a')},
{nil, "<nil>"},
}
for _, tt := range tests {
p := NewByteFormatter(tt.p)
s := fmt.Sprintf("%v", p)
if s != tt.s {
t.Errorf("{%+v}.Format() = %q; want %q", p, s, tt.s)
}
}
}
